Re: what kind of msd should i get
I've run both the Pro-Billet and MSD-6AL box and they help immensely, wether on a stock engine or a built one, you will notice more performance gains on a built motor, but I can honestly say the MSD dizzy and 6AL really woke up my old TPI motor. It certainly couldn't hurt emissions, you are definitely burning more fuel off w/ a hotter , multiple firing spark...
